A federal judge overseeing the fraud prosecution against the SantaCon event organizer expressed clear skepticism during the defendant's initial court appearance. The case centers on allegations related to New York City's popular holiday-themed bar crawl event. Legal proceedings reveal potential financial misconduct tied to ticket sales and event management. The judge's demeanor suggests serious concerns about the defendant's credibility and the nature of charges presented.
